systemd-hostnamed.service systemd Developer Lennart Poettering lennart@poettering.net systemd-hostnamed.service 8 systemd-hostnamed.service systemd-hostnamed Host name bus mechanism systemd-hostnamed.service /usr/lib/systemd/systemd-hostnamed Description systemd-hostnamed is a system service that may be used as a mechanism to change the system's hostname. systemd-hostnamed is automatically activated on request and terminates itself when it is unused. The tool hostnamectl1 is a command-line client to this service. See the developer documentation for information about the APIs systemd-hostnamed provides.
